Enhancing Green Digital Finance in Cambodia: ERIA–NBC Technical Working Group Meeting

Phnom Penh, 19 September 2025 – ERIA and the National Bank of Cambodia (NBC) convened a Technical Working Group Meeting on 18–19 September 2025 at the Hyatt Regency Phnom Penh. Titled 'Enhancing Green Digital Finance in Cambodia: Preliminary Results and Analyses,' the 2-day meeting marked an important step in shaping Cambodia’s green finance framework and preparing for the upcoming stakeholder consultation workshop.

The discussions centred on survey results and stakeholder interviews, which provided insights into opportunities and challenges in advancing green digital finance. Key topics included technical frameworks, risk mitigation, and potential applications of digital innovation in Cambodia’s green finance ecosystem.

Opening remarks were delivered by Dr Ith Hero, Deputy Director General of Policy and International Cooperation at NBC, and Dr Han Phoumin, Senior Energy Economist at ERIA, who both stressed the importance of aligning financial innovation with Cambodia’s nationally determined contribution (NDC) and broader sustainable development goals.

Over the course of the meeting, NBC and ERIA experts presented and analysed preliminary findings:

  • Survey results and data analysis, presented by Dr Sreyleak Mon (NBC).
  • Stakeholder interview findings involving financial institutions, development partners, regulators, business associations, green businesses, and fintech companies, presented by NBC representatives.
  • Interactive commentary sessions, led by Dr Han Phoumin and Dr Fauziah Zen (ERIA), which provided policy insights and constructive feedback.

The second day focused on refining the draft report, clarifying roles between ERIA and NBC, and setting the agenda for the forthcoming stakeholder consultation workshop. This workshop will bring together a broader range of actors from Cambodia’s financial and business sectors to validate findings and shape next steps.
